Insight 5 Day Training: An Introduction to Participatory Video (Mar 3-7 2008)

Start Date

March 3 2008

End Date

March 7 2008

Location

Oxford, United Kingdom

Event summary

Organised by Insight, this training hopes to contribute to participating organisations' and individuals' work on popular knowledge creation and communication for social change. The training is suitable for development practitioners and activists who have an interest or are seeking ways of strengthening citizens' voice (particularly the economically poor and marginalised) to have a greater impact on decision–making processes and advocacy for social justice.

Course Objectives:

  1. To deepen participants' understanding of Participatory Video (PV): what it is, why it is important, its uses and underpinning principles.
  2. To equip participants with hands-on skills/techniques and practical steps for initiating, setting up and facilitating a PV process.
  3. To provide the participants with an opportunity to reflect on the training experience, share their insights on the usefulness of PV in their work/organisations.

Methodology and Content:

The training will be participatory and practical. The training methodology will employ principles of experiential learning: employing a wide range of visual techniques that enhance creativity, sharing, reflection and learning. These will include games and group exercises such as role plays, drama, drawing, and others.


Course Participants:

The training is designed for a maximum of 12 participants. No previous video experience needed but experience of participatory methods (PRA/PLA/Reflect) and/or good facilitation skills are recommended.
